세계의 차세대 암 진단약 시장, 2030년에는 미국에서 646억 달러에 달할 전망

2024년에 198억 달러로 추정되는 세계의 차세대 암 진단약 시장은 분석 기간인 2024-2030년에 21.8%의 CAGR로 성장하며, 2030년에는 646억 달러에 달할 것으로 예측됩니다. 이 리포트에서 분석한 부문의 하나인 qPCR & Multiplexing Technology는 CAGR 22.8%를 기록하며, 분석 기간 종료시에는 282억 달러에 달할 것으로 예측됩니다. 차세대 시퀀스 기술 분야의 성장률은 분석 기간 중 CAGR 17.9%로 추정됩니다.

미국 시장은 57억 달러로 추정, 중국은 CAGR 21.0%로 성장 예측

미국의 차세대 암 진단약 시장은 2024년에 57억 달러로 추정됩니다. 세계 2위의 경제대국인 중국은 2030년까지 99억 달러의 시장 규모에 달할 것으로 예측되며, 분석 기간인 2024-2030년의 CAGR은 21.0%입니다. 기타 주목할 만한 지역별 시장으로는 일본과 캐나다가 있으며, 분석 기간 중 CAGR은 각각 19.3%와 18.0%로 예측됩니다. 유럽에서는 독일이 CAGR 약 14.8%로 성장할 것으로 예측됩니다.

세계의 차세대 암 진단약 시장 - 주요 동향과 촉진요인 정리

차세대 암 진단약은 어떻게 종양학에 혁명을 일으키고 있는가?

차세대 암 진단법(NGCD)은 다양한 암의 조기 발견, 정확한 진단, 맞춤 치료를 위한 첨단 툴을 제공하며 종양학 분야의 비약적인 발전을 상징합니다. 이러한 진단법은 액체생검, 유전체학, 유전체학, 단백질학, 차세대 염기서열 분석(NGS) 등 다양한 기술을 포괄하고 있습니다. 기존 진단과 달리 NGCD는 상세한 분자적 인사이트을 제공하므로 암 전문의가 암 진행을 촉진하는 유전자 돌연변이 및 바이오마커를 이해할 수 있습니다. 이러한 정확성은 표적 치료를 가능하게 하여 환자의 예후를 개선하고 부작용을 줄일 수 있습니다. 전 세계에서 암 유병률이 증가하는 가운데, NGCD는 보다 개인화되고, 신속하고, 효과적인 암 치료를 실현함으로써 암 치료의 변화에 중요한 역할을 하고 있습니다.

차세대 암 진단 시장의 주요 부문은?

주요 기술로는 액체생검, NGS, 단백질체학, 생물정보학, 생물정보학 툴 등이 있으며, 액체생검과 NGS는 비침습적 특성과 유전자 변화를 감지하는 능력으로 인해 큰 지지를 받고 있습니다. 응용 측면에서 NGCD는 스크리닝, 진단 검사, 치료 반응 모니터링에 사용되고 있습니다. 유방암, 폐암, 대장암과 같은 조기 암 검진은 조기 발견을 통해 생존율을 크게 향상시킬 수 있는 주요 용도이며, NGCD의 주요 최종사용자로는 병원, 진단 실험실, 연구 기관이 있으며, 이들 모두는 암 관리의 정확성과 효율성을 높이기 위해 이러한 기술을 임상 워크플로우에 통합하고 있습니다. 워크플로우에 통합하고 있습니다.

NGCD 기술은 헬스케어 분야 간 어떻게 통합되고 있는가?

병원과 종양센터는 특히 고위험군 환자 및 유전성 암 증후군 환자를 대상으로 NGCD를 일상적인 암 검진 및 진단 프로토콜에 통합하고 있습니다. 진단 실험실는 NGCD를 사용하여 유전체 및 단백질체 검사를 수행하여 특정 돌연변이 및 치료 옵션을 식별하고 정밀의료를 지원합니다. 연구기관은 임상시험 수행, 암 유전체학 연구, 신약 타깃 발굴을 위해 이러한 진단법을 활용하고 있습니다. 제약사들도 NGCD 개발자와 협력하여 약물의 효능을 예측하는 바이오마커를 찾아내어 약품 개발을 개선하고 임상시험을 가속화하고 있습니다. 또한 원격의료 플랫폼은 원격 환자 모니터링을 위해 NGCD를 통합하기 시작했으며, 암 진단을 더욱 친숙하게 만들고 있습니다.

차세대 암 진단약 시장 성장을 가속하는 요인은?

차세대 암 진단 시장의 성장은 암 유병률 증가로 인해 보다 효과적인 스크리닝 및 진단 툴에 대한 수요가 증가하는 등 여러 가지 요인에 의해 주도되고 있습니다. 유전체학 및 단백질체학의 발전으로 인한 맞춤형 의료로의 전환은 NGCDs의 채택을 더욱 촉진하고 있습니다. 액체생검 기술의 급속한 발전은 NGS 플랫폼의 개선과 함께 진단 정확도를 높여 NGCD를 현대 종양학에 필수적인 요소로 만들었습니다. 또한 암 연구 및 진단 기술 혁신에 대한 규제 당국의 승인과 정부의 자금 지원도 시장 성장에 기여하고 있습니다. 또한 암 조기 발견에 대한 인식이 높아지고 유전자 검사 서비스가 확대됨에 따라 헬스케어 부문 전반에서 NGCD에 대한 수요가 증가하고 있습니다.

Global Next Generation Cancer Diagnostics Market to Reach US$64.6 Billion by 2030

The global market for Next Generation Cancer Diagnostics estimated at US$19.8 Billion in the year 2024, is expected to reach US$64.6 Billion by 2030, growing at a CAGR of 21.8% over the analysis period 2024-2030. qPCR & Multiplexing Technology, one of the segments analyzed in the report, is expected to record a 22.8% CAGR and reach US$28.2 Billion by the end of the analysis period. Growth in the Next Generation Sequencing Technology segment is estimated at 17.9% CAGR over the analysis period.

The U.S. Market is Estimated at US$5.7 Billion While China is Forecast to Grow at 21.0% CAGR

The Next Generation Cancer Diagnostics market in the U.S. is estimated at US$5.7 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$9.9 Billion by the year 2030 trailing a CAGR of 21.0%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 19.3% and 18.0%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 14.8% CAGR.

Global Next Generation Cancer Diagnostics Market - Key Trends and Drivers Summarized

How Are Next Generation Cancer Diagnostics Revolutionizing Oncology?

Next Generation Cancer Diagnostics (NGCD) represent a leap forward in the field of oncology, offering advanced tools for early detection, accurate diagnosis, and personalized treatment of various cancers. These diagnostics encompass a broad range of technologies, including liquid biopsy, genomics, proteomics, and next-generation sequencing (NGS). Unlike traditional diagnostics, NGCDs provide detailed molecular insights, enabling oncologists to understand the genetic mutations and biomarkers that drive cancer progression. This precision enables targeted therapies, improving patient outcomes and reducing side effects. As the prevalence of cancer rises globally, NGCDs are playing a critical role in transforming cancer care by making it more personalized, faster, and more effective.

What Are The Key Segments in the Next Generation Cancer Diagnostics Market?

Key technologies include liquid biopsy, NGS, proteomics, and bioinformatics tools, with liquid biopsy and NGS gaining significant traction due to their non-invasive nature and ability to detect genetic alterations. In terms of applications, NGCDs are used in screening, diagnostic testing, and monitoring treatment response. Screening for early-stage cancers, such as breast, lung, and colorectal cancers, is a major application segment, where early detection significantly improves survival rates. Major end-users of NGCDs include hospitals, diagnostic laboratories, and research institutes, all of which are integrating these technologies into clinical workflows to enhance precision and efficiency in cancer management.

How Are NGCD Technologies Being Integrated Across Healthcare Sectors?

Hospitals and oncology centers are integrating NGCDs into routine cancer screening and diagnostic protocols, particularly for high-risk patients and those with hereditary cancer syndromes. Diagnostic laboratories use NGCDs to perform genomic and proteomic tests that aid in identifying specific mutations and treatment options, supporting precision medicine. Research institutes are leveraging these diagnostics to conduct clinical trials, study cancer genomics, and explore new drug targets. Pharmaceutical companies also collaborate with NGCD developers to identify biomarkers that predict drug efficacy, thereby improving drug development and accelerating clinical trials. Additionally, telehealth platforms are beginning to incorporate NGCDs for remote patient monitoring, making cancer diagnostics more accessible.

What Factors Are Driving the Growth in the Next Generation Cancer Diagnostics Market?

The growth in the Next Generation Cancer Diagnostics market is driven by several factors, including the increasing prevalence of cancer, which has heightened the demand for more effective screening and diagnostic tools. The shift toward personalized medicine, driven by advancements in genomics and proteomics, has further fueled the adoption of NGCDs. The rapid development of liquid biopsy technologies, coupled with improvements in NGS platforms, has enhanced diagnostic accuracy, making NGCDs indispensable in modern oncology. Regulatory approvals and government funding for cancer research and diagnostic innovation are also contributing to market growth. Additionally, the growing awareness of early cancer detection and the expansion of genetic testing services have increased the demand for NGCDs across healthcare sectors.
